Old Town

There is a geocache (maybe a series) that has to do with the history of Baumholder. There is still a part of the original town wall and some buildings from the end of the fifteenth century. This bit of history is not apparent on casual perusing of town. It is off the main shopping part of town by a few blocks and up a steep incline in town.
